Qualityfxtrade.com

Investment scams
https://qualityfxtrade.com

Qualityfxtrade.com runs an investment scam. They promise huge returns, but once you invest, they take your money and disappear. A foreign entity owns and operates the site, and the business address listed is fake. The scam was uncovered just 23 days after the site launched. There’s no customer service phone number available.

An investment scam tricks people into investing money with promises of high returns, only to steal the funds.

An investment scam involves fraudsters convincing individuals to invest money in fake opportunities. Scammers often promise high returns with little or no risk. They create a sense of urgency, pressuring victims to act quickly. Fraudsters may use impressive-sounding jargon to appear credible. They might claim insider knowledge or guaranteed profits. Fake websites and testimonials are common tactics to build trust. Scammers often target vulnerable individuals, such as the elderly. They exploit emotions and build personal relationships. Once they receive the money, they disappear, leaving victims with significant losses. These scams can take many forms, including Ponzi schemes or fake stock options. Always be cautious when approached with investment offers that seem too good to be true.
